Roof replacement is inevitable.


A roof’s primary purpose is to shelter your home in Plainfield, Illinois from the elements. It helps prevent dust, dirt, rain, hail, snow, branches, and even animals from entering your home. The presence of a roof also reduces the energy consumed by your heating and air conditioning units, as cooler air is retained during the summer and warmer air is retained during the winter. If your roofing system fails to handle these responsibilities effectively, it might be time to perform roofing maintenance and/or repairs.


It is worth noting, though, that while maintenance and repair work will help your roofing system last a little longer, it will ultimately need to be replaced. When the inevitable happens, it is more economically viable to invest in a roof replacement as quickly as possible.


Roof replacement is well worth the expense.


The cost of a roof replacement in Plainfield, Illinois can seem daunting at first, but in the end, it’s an expense that is well worth the money.


A leaky or cracked roof allows hot and cold air to escape, forcing air conditioners and heating units to operate harder and consume more energy. You can identify leaks and cracks in your roof by hiring a licensed Plainfield, Illinois roofing contractor to perform regular roof inspections. When these inspections are not performed regularly, trouble spots are not identified, and the roofing system deteriorates, allowing allergenic fungi or water to accumulate within the structure. This significantly weakens the roofing structure over time and may even cause it to collapse. A roof replacement will provide your home with a roof that is free of leaks and cracks, allowing you to rest easy, knowing that your roof is providing necessary protection.


Another aspect to consider when evaluating the cost of a roof replacement in Plainfield, Illinois is how the new roof would influence your property’s value. A new roof will still be under warranty and require minimal maintenance work and/or repairs in the near future. If you choose to replace your roof, you will also boost your property’s marketability, increasing the possibility of a faster sale.


Hire the right roofing contractor in Plainfield, Illinois


You should do your due diligence before hiring a Chicagoland roofing contractor to replace your roofing system. Ideally, the roofing contractor should be able to provide references and have several years of experience. In addition, the roofing contractor should have legitimate and verifiable liability insurance and workers’ compensation insurance, be able to operate under tight deadlines, and provide some form of guarantee on the replacement work. Hiring a professional roofing contractor to replace your roof will ensure that you get the best return on your investment.
